Malinao, Aklan, Philippines

Overview

Malinao is a charming rural municipality situated in Aklan, Philippines, known for its picturesque rice fields, friendly locals, and laid-back atmosphere. The town offers a genuine glimpse into provincial Filipino life, with easy access to nature and traditional community events.

Best Time to Visit

December to May for cooler, dry weather and lively local festivals.

Local Tips

Public transportation is mostly by tricycle or jeepney; cash is preferred at small shops. English and Filipino are widely spoken, but learning a few local phrases is appreciated.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ly, especially in rural areas. Tipping is not required but appreciated for good service. Greet elders respectfully and observe local customs, especially during community occasions.

Safety Warnings

Malinao is generally safe, but exercise caution at night in remote areas and be wary of pickpockets in crowded markets. Avoid walking alone on unlit paths after dark.

Hidden Gems

Visit local hot springs in nearby barangays, explore Bulabud's scenic rice terraces, and join seasonal fiestas for a true local experience.
